After our failure to find a Dinosaur track earlier in our trip, we decided to try and find one at a designated Dinosaur track site! Maybe it was just too easy. The area where this track rested was a long elevated shelf that John decided to explore. Beautiful rocks and plants but the unexpected. As he stepped between bushes on his way down a slope, he heard the distinct sound of a snakes rattle! A leap to safety, he went back to find the culprit. it was a very small, orangish snake deep in the bush--couldn't tell if there might have been two in there.
We then went on to another place John discovered years ago, an old shed(?) dug out of, or covered by, earth. Lots has changed in the canyon here but the shack was still there as were some amazing rock formations.
We end our day in a campsite in the Swinging Bridge North Campground. We would normally have boondocked, but with rain threatening and only one person off in another site, this place fit the bill--small fee for a close restroom! Our first fire and entertaining bats topped off the evening!
